Gravel driveway installation involves preparing the ground and laying down a durable layer of gravel to create a functional and attractive driveway surface. This service typically begins with site assessment and excavation to ensure proper grading and drainage. Once the area is prepared, a base layer of larger gravel may be spread to provide stability, followed by a finer gravel topcoat that offers a smooth, solid surface. This process helps establish a reliable driveway that can withstand regular vehicle use and varying weather conditions.

Installing a gravel driveway can address common problems such as mud, erosion, and uneven surfaces that often occur with dirt or poorly maintained driveways. Gravel provides excellent drainage, reducing the risk of puddles and water pooling that can lead to erosion or damage over time. Additionally, a properly installed gravel driveway can help prevent rutting and shifting, which are frequent issues on softer or poorly compacted surfaces. This makes gravel an effective choice for homeowners seeking a low-maintenance, cost-effective solution to improve access and curb appeal.

The overview below groups typical Gravel Driveway Installation proj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Jacksonville, NC.

In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.

Smaller Repairs - Typical costs for minor gravel driveway repairs, such as filling in low spots or patching small areas, generally range from $250-$600. Many routine fixes fall within this middle range, depending on the extent of the work needed.

Basic Installation - Installing a new gravel driveway or replacing an existing one usually costs between $1,200-$3,000 for most projects. Larger, more complex installations can reach $4,000 or more, but most projects fall within the mid-range.

Full Replacement - Complete removal and replacement of an old driveway with gravel typically ranges from $3,500-$7,000, depending on size and site conditions. Fewer projects push into the highest tiers, which are reserved for larger or more detailed work.

Custom or Large-Scale Projects - Extensive gravel driveway installations, including extensive grading or significant site prep, can exceed $7,000 and reach upwards of $10,000+ in some cases. These larger projects are less common but are handled by local contractors for specialized needs.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What are the benefits of choosing gravel for a driveway? Gravel driveways provide good drainage, are cost-effective, and can be easier to install compared to other materials, making them a popular choice for many properties in Jacksonville, NC.

How do local contractors prepare the site for gravel driveway installation? Contractors typically clear the area, level the ground, and may add a base layer of larger stones to ensure stability and proper drainage for the gravel surface.

What types of gravel are commonly used for driveway installation? Common options include crushed stone, pea gravel, and decomposed granite, each offering different textures and drainage qualities suitable for various preferences and needs.

Are there any maintenance considerations for gravel driveways? Regular raking to redistribute gravel, adding more gravel as needed, and occasional grading help maintain the driveway’s appearance and functionality over time.
